You can. Download the ZIP version, extract it somewhere, run the executable and skip profile migration. You'll end up with a fresh profile, in a new location, and your current SeaMonkey will be unaffected. Then you can install the extension and try it out. Just quit your current SeaMonkey before you do, or start the new one with the -no-remote command line option. Once you want to actually switch, start the extracted version with the -P command line parameter once and delete the test profile from the Profile Manager. Then remove the extracted version and proceed with installing the new SeaMonkey version using the installer (if you like).
